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Conditions: The type and condition of the soil can impact installation difficulty and time.
- Load Requirements: Higher load requirements may necessitate more robust or additional piles.
- Pile Length and Diameter: Longer or wider piles typically cost more due to increased material use.
- Site Accessibility: Hard-to-reach sites can increase labor and equipment costs.
- Installation Depth: Deeper installations require more time and resources.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may add to the cost through required permits and inspections.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Phenix City, AL, can vary, affecting overall costs.
- Equipment Rental: Specialized equipment may be needed, influencing the final price.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task | Average Cost (Phenix City, AL) |
|---|---|
| Initial Site Assessment | $200 - $500 |
| Soil Testing | $500 - $1,500 |
| Helical Pile Installation (per pile)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
| Equipment Rental | $500 - $1,000 per day |
| Labor | $50 - $100 per hour |
| Total Installation (average home) | $10,000 - $30,000 |
